GOALKEEPER Will Puddy has rejected an offer from Hereford FC and signed for National League South side Chippenham Town.

The 30-year-old goalkeeper played a host of games for the Bulls towards the end of last season providing competition for Martin Horsell.

He was offered a deal to remain at Edgar Street this season but instead signed for Chippenham.

Hereford currently have Horsell as the only goalkeeper signed for the coming pre-season.

Chippenham Town manager Mark Collier said: "Will had many offers including the chance to stay full time, however having found employment locally he has agreed to sign, having worked with talented keeper previously I am fully aware we have secured the services of a top keeper"
